## Escalation: BigDiff Viewer

If BigDiff hangs on files over 200 MB, kill the worker and retry once. Still stuck? Check the chunker logs for truncation errors. Do not restart the shared render node yourself — contractors lack the permission and a bad restart drops everyone's sessions. Escalate instead, including the file size and log excerpt, to the tooling desk.

escalation mailbox, hahof-fahag: istwyn.prawyn@qirvanlabs.internal

Step 4: Enable soft deletes on the orders table. The Marlowe Retail migration adds a deleted_at column and swaps hard DELETE calls in the orders service for an UPDATE that stamps the timestamp. Reviewers should confirm that every read path in the Quillback API filters on deleted_at IS NULL, and that the nightly purge job respects the 90-day retention window. The purge worker authenticates to the archive store before removing rows, so add the credential line below to the service's .env file.

vault entry, yahif-yajep: COURIER_KEY29=b802bdf8034096b65a51c6ba5abe2

// Fixture for the Parcelhawk webhook tests — discussed at weekly sync.
// Simulates three delivery events: out-for-delivery, delayed, delivered.
// The delayed event intentionally arrives out of order; dedup logic
// should still land the parcel in "delivered" state.
// Heads up: these hit the shared staging endpoint, so don't loop them.
// Requests authenticate with the token below.

portal login ticket: eyJhbGciOiJIUzI1NiIsInR5cCI6IkpXVCJ9.eyJzdWIiOiIYVgTyo3M-MIn0.PRnVS6uMEYGo

Hey folks,

Quick recap for the sync: the Brindlewick wiki is now fully on role-based access. Legacy per-page ACLs were migrated Saturday, and the old permissions service is in read-only mode until we're confident nothing broke. A few teams noticed pages locked tighter than expected — that's the new default-deny behavior, not a bug, so route complaints to space admins rather than reopening the migration. Permission caching is aggressive now, so edits can take a minute to propagate. The access service is running with the values below.

config for kafof-bawef:
holath:
  log_level: debug
  metrics_host: metrics.holath.qorvelsys.internal
  pin: 2191
  pool_size: 32